岗位职责:1、根据研发中心总体规划,负责航空公司运控系统方向的软件技术架构、系统性能优化等技术方案设计工作,负责系统模块的详细设计工作;2、负责系统重要功能模块的代码编写和代码管理工作,并编写软件开发过程等技术文档;根据开发进度要求及需求的优先级,配合部门合理组织、使用、指导内外部开发资源,指导下层级人员完成开发工作,并对其他开发人员的代码进行审核及代码质量改进;3、根据研发中心软件测试规范和测试验收标准,编写单元测试用例和脚本,对所编写代码进行单元测试,配合进行系统集成测试、性能和压力测试、验收测试等;根据测试结果进行代码修改及优化,并对开发的系统性能数据进行有效的分析;4、根据研发中心代码质量管理制度和代码质量验收标准,配合研发中心和部门进行相关技术评审,对不符合应用和系统发展战略的设计和流程提出建议,以保障产品的合理性;5、承担或协助完成系统升级任务及日常生产问题排查工作,提供技术支持和解决方案,研究、解决系统开发或生产过程中遇到的技术难题;6、根据系统运行情况,提出系统优化方案并组织实施;7、对团队内技术人员进行技术培训和技术指导,配合研发中心进行新员工培训工作。任职要求:1、大学本科及以上学历,计算机及相关专业; 2、硕士毕业后6年或本科毕业后7年以上相关领域工作经验; 3、具备前端开发工作经验,熟练掌握Vue、Electron 、Antdesign等前端框架和组件; 4、熟练掌握Java及SpringBoot、Mybatis等开源框架,并有微服务开发及治理经验; 5、参与过云化/云原生项目的设计和开发,具备航空公司运控相关项目(如签派放行系统、飞行计划系统、飞行监控系统、机组排班系统等)开发经验者优先; 6、熟悉分布式、多线程、缓存、消息等高性能架构相关开发技术;熟悉工作流引擎、规则引擎。具备实际项目应用经验者优先; 7、熟悉主流数据库、OceanBase、GaussDB、Redis等数据库软件,参与过数据平台搭建工作,具备航空公司运控数据(航空情报导航数据、航空气象数据、飞机性能数据等)处理经验者优先; 8、具备较强的学习能力和沟通能力,具备良好的团队合作精神 ,有带团队经验者优先。